Logistics Coordinator, Offshore

Offshore Responsibilities:

Drivers Management:

  • Follow up on the passes and documents validity for the equipment and operators.
  • Update staff information and contact update.
  • Accommodation and travel planning for Drivers.
  • Make sure that the operators are well established in sites with suitable conditions.
  • Arrange Drivers PPE's.
  • Ensure all trainings are conducted as per the requirement.

Rotations Planning:

  • Arrange Technical, safety and practical training of new offshore employees and drivers.
  • Monthly reporting of project/ personnel rotation and activities to operations manager.
  • Sporadic offshore rotation trips; the tasks may be changed according to project needs.
  • Leave planning and Travel history tracking for all operators in the island as per internal HR and site requirement.

Maintenance Coordination:

  • Ensuring Sub-contractors on-time maintenance and repair responses.
  • Coordinating with Sub-contractor on-time deliveries of spare parts and equipment replacements in case of failure.
  • Lead meeting to review maintenance work completed (Daily/Weekly/Routine Maintenance), finalize the next work to be done.
  • Plan Purchase orders for due maintenance activities (One Month before). Ensures accurate estimate of this work. Writes the requisitions for unplanned work.
  • Summarize and report all the work done to the Operations manager.
  • Maintains a cost ledger for all work (planned and upcoming) with estimated or actual cost (with input from Planners, suppliers quotes).
  • Maintain a good relation with the Contractors.
  • Ensure to follow Line Manager and/or QHSE Manager/Assistant QHSE Manager & Senior QHSE Supervisor Instructions, which are in line with policies and guidelines.
  • Report any hazardous condition to the immediate supervisor or department manager and warn other employees for their safety.
  • Follow up on the Spare parts shipping to the island.
  • Prepare the DN for shipped items and consignment for demobilized Equipment from site.

Reporting:

  • Update the project trackers in order to keep update of all operations:
  • Master sheet
  • Operators sheet
  • Equipment tracker
  • Purchase Orders tracker
  • Invoice Trackers
  • Accruals and profit trackers.
  • Provide regularly updated reports to the operations manager on the status of implementation against project goals and objectives:
  • Monthly Maintenance Report (Daily, Biweekly and routine maintenance with actual dates).
  • LPOs and expenses against maintenance due Report.
  • Maintenance due report.
  • Monthly Rotations report.
  • Improvement: Work in our internal Programs development.
  • Ensure the achievement on the project profitability and KPI's.

Systems and Applications:

  • Optima Application.
  • IVMS tracking system application.
  • Propose improvement suggestions/opportunities, risk reducing and corrective actions.

HSE:

  • Adhere to Client's and Company HSE objectives and KPI's.
  • Coordinate with Internal HSE manager in order to provide input and reporting if required.
  • Reporting of incidents that might cause personnel injury, damage to the environment or other person's property.
  • Ensure the corrective actions in order to close the remarks following inspection reports raised by end user.
  • Assure safety awareness.
  • Ensure collecting MSDS for the equipment received from supplier and ensure proper storing conditions upon HSE coordinator advice.
  • Participate in the incident investigation and reporting.
  • Prepare audit plans.

Onshore:

  • Preparation of client timesheets.
  • Suppliers Timesheets: Upon confirmation from client confirm the same with suppliers.
  • Invoicing: Forward the approved timesheets to finance team for PI creation and follow up on the due Purchase orders by end user.
  • Create Jobs for Equipment Rental of the Month by 25th of each Month.
  • Calculate and book the accruals in the Job created.
  • Follow Up on the Invoices for the Month KPI to receive by maximum 15th of the following month.
  • Compare the Invoices amount with the contract rates and approved timesheets.
  • Raise the received invoices in the system.
  • Arrange Purchase Orders for additional equipment.

Qualifications & Characteristics:

Education: Mechanical background.

Work Experience:

  • 5 years experience in Oil & Gas.
  • Offshore experience is a must.

Specific Skills:

  • Excellent Communication skills.
  • Organization/Coordination Skills.
  • MS Office Skills - Excellent Excel and PowerPoint skills.
  • Time Management.
